 Nollywood actress, Mercy Johnson, who is the Senior Special Assistant to the Kogi state Governor on Entertainment, Arts and Culture hosted her first Kogi State Stakeholders Summit on Entertainment, Art and Culture, on Wednesday, April 26. Governor Yahaya Bello alongside other dignitaries were present at the event which was held to unearth ways of promoting entertainment in the State. Mercy bagged her appointment in the early part of April.
